About Midwest Vision Partners Vision is a precious gift. Midwest Vision Partners (MVP) is focused on improving and preserving it for as many patients as possible by cultivating a network of world‑class ophthalmologists and optometrists who provide exceptional, patient‑centered care. Headquartered in Chicago, MVP proudly supports prominent eye care professionals in 70+ locations across Ohio, Michigan, Pennsylvania, West Virginia, and Illinois, with over 140 physicians and 1,500 employees all focused on providing top‑notch, customized results for each of our patients.

Key Responsibilities

Coordinate all physician schedules to ensure smooth appointment flow

Call patients to reschedule appointments as needed

Contact patients who may not have responded to reminder calls and assertively ensure appointments are rescheduled (telemarketing)

Type and distribute weekly doctor schedules to all medical/surgical offices and staff

Send information packets or mass mailings to patients and/or offices when requested

Ensure appropriate documentation is provided in each patient record

Assure incoming and outgoing clinical summaries and referrals are appropriately placed in the patient record

Ensure referrals are received as necessary by doctor or insurance

Triage calls properly to assure location doctor compliance

Be willing and able to be on‑site 2-3 times per month for training and continuous education

Achieve Quality and NPS score requirements

Comply with all organizational policies and procedures, including standard operating procedures and the Employee Handbook

Meet Call Center Remote Work Technology requirements (see addendum)

Perform various other duties as requested
